Römerbrunnen
Römerbrunnen is a reservoir in Lower Austria, Austria. Römerbrunnen is situated nearby to the locality Hagental, as well as near Pfarrwald.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Stockerau
Town
Photo: Bwag, CC BY-SA 4.0.
Stockerau is a town in the district of Korneuburg in Lower Austria, Austria. Stockerau has 16,974 inhabitants, which makes it the largest town in the Weinviertel. Stockerau is situated 7 km north of Römerbrunnen.
